Planting Calendar for Runner beans

Frost tolerance for runner beans: Not tolerant of frost.
When to plant: After the last frost when the weather gets warmer.

You can not plant runner beans until after the last frost has passed because they require warm weather.

The earliest that you can plant runner beans in Waseca is May. However, you really should wait until June if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ant runner beans and expect a good harvest is probably August. If you wait any later than that and your runner beans may not have a chance to fully mature. If you are starting your runner beans indoors then you might be able to get away with starting them a little bit earlier.

Last Frost Date

On average the last frost is on May 15 in Waseca. It might get as low as -25°F during the coldest months of winter.

Just be sure to remember that USDA zone info for Waseca may not be accurate from year to year and the actual date of last frost can change quite a bit from year to year. Half of the time in Waseca last frost occurs after May 15 so make sure that you are ready to protect your runner beans in the event of a surprise late frost.

USDA Zone Info for Waseca

Here is the info for USDA Zone 4b.

Average Date of Last Frost (spring)May 15
Average Date of First Frost (fall)September 15
Lowest Expected Low-25°F
Highest Expected Low-20°F

This means that on a really cold year, the coldest it will get is -25°F. On most years you should be prepared to experience lows near -20°F.
